Liberty University’s Department of Biology and Chemistry is hosting its first Summer Science Camp for incoming freshman and local high school students from June 24 to 28.
From 9 a.m. to 3:30 p.m., campers will participate in two sessions where they can try various activities in science including EKGs to look at heart electrical activity, forensic science with fingerprinting and crime scene assessment, human cadaver dissection, organic chemistry and microbiology, and so much more. Sessions will be hands-on under the supervision of Liberty professors, undergrad, and graduate students.
